About the role
Intertek’s Building Science Solutions (BSS) group focuses on building enclosure consulting, commissioning, and field performance testing for new construction and retrofit projects. As a Field Testing Technician, you will perform field testing, observations, and inspections of construction materials, including below-grade waterproofing, air barriers, cladding, glazing, and roofing systems. Projects vary in size and location, spanning commercial, residential, higher education, healthcare, and large municipal sectors. This position requires up to 25% overnight/out-of-town travel.
Responsibilities
- Perform a variety of testing, project-specific observations, and site assessment duties under direct supervision or from detailed controlled procedures.
- Operate testing equipment and conduct testing (e.g., air and water infiltration).
- Provide assessment of data through reporting and prepare professionally written field reports.
- Work utilizing drawings, specifications, and diagrams.
- Use specific methods to observe site activities and perform tasks.
- Make detailed observations and provide recommendations for improvements.
- Maintain detailed documentation and data from test results.
- Communicate effectively with client and project teams.
